Course Summary

The Compliance Regulatory Professionals training course equips participants with the essential knowledge and skills to understand and support regulatory compliance and enterprise-wide risk management. It explores regulatory frameworks, markets, and products, and emphasises best practices aligned with business objectives and international standards. Participants learn how to establish effective systems and controls, develop compliance monitoring programs, and build risk-based Customer Due Diligence processes, enhancing proficiency in compliance-related functions. By fostering the ability to engage positively with regulators, board members, and colleagues across organisational levels, the Compliance Regulatory Professionals training course enables professionals to manage compliance responsibilities with confidence and reduce organisational risk.

The course further strengthens participants’ understanding of compliance roles, governance principles, and risk mitigation strategies, ensuring practical application in real workplace scenarios. Participants gain insight into developing compliance culture, managing risks, and interpreting compliance requirements to support organisational resilience. Emphasis is placed on translating theoretical knowledge into practical compliance tools that contribute to effective risk management and enhanced organisational reputation. The Compliance Regulatory Professionals training course prepares professionals to contribute meaningfully to compliance functions and safeguard their organisations against regulatory challenges.

Course Outline
Day 1

The Regulatory Environment and the Role of Regulators

This day introduces participants to the regulatory environment and the expectations of regulators. It explores international frameworks, the role of regulators, and best practices that support compliance obligations. The topics covered will include:   

  • An Overview of the Regulatory Environment
  • The Objectives of Financial Services Regulation
  • International Regulation
  • The Role of the Regulators
  • What do the Regulators expect?
  • Your Jurisdiction Environment
  • The Best Practice in Regulatory Obligation
  • ISO 19600: Compliance Management Systems
Day 2

The Compliance Functions

This day focuses on the structure and roles within compliance functions, including board, audit, and compliance officer responsibilities. It also examines corporate governance, conflict management, and ongoing compliance activities. The topics covered will include:  

  • Compliance Structure
  • The Role of the Board of Directors, the Supervisors, the Internal and External Auditors
  • Responsibilities of the Compliance Officer
  • Key Compliance Activities and Processes
  • Compliance and Corporate Governance
  • Corporate Governance and Financial Crime Prevention
  • Compliance Training
  • Conflicts of Interest
  • Ongoing Compliance with Laws and Regulations
Day 3

Risk Management and Compliance Risk

This day develops understanding of risk management approaches and internal controls. Participants explore compliance culture, risk assessment, and managing internal and external relationships. The topics covered will include:

  • Understanding a Risk Management Approach
  • Creating a Risk Management Approach
  • The Definition of Governance, Risk and Compliance
  • The Need for Internal Controls
  • Identify, Mitigate and Control Risks Effectively
  • Approaches to Risk Assessment
  • The Importance of Compliance Culture
  • Managing Key Relationships – external and internal
Day 4

Establishing an Effective Compliance Function

This day focuses on designing and implementing compliance systems. Participants learn about internal policies, monitoring programs, record-keeping, and regulatory change management. The topics covered will include:

  • Factors to be Considered in Designing a Compliance System
  • Developing an Internal Compliance System
  • Implementing and Communicating Internal Compliance Arrangement
  • Compliance Manual
  • Establishing Policies and Procedures
  • Creating a Compliance Monitoring Program
  • The Need for Independence
  • Record Keeping ƒ Compliance Reports
  • Managing the Regulators and Change in Regulations
Day 5

Managing the Risk of Money Laundering and Financial Crimes

This day addresses financial crime risks and compliance responsibilities in anti-money laundering, fraud prevention, market abuse, and sanctions. Participants explore risk-based approaches and monitoring techniques. The topics covered will include:   

  • Understanding Money Laundering Offences
  • MLRO and Compliance Officer
  • The Risk-based Approach to Money Laundering / Terrorist Financing
  • Suspicious Activity Monitoring, Detection and Reporting
  • Preventing Fraud
  • Bribery and Corruption
  • Insider Trading
  • Market Abuse
  • Sanctions and their Role in the Global Economy
